WebJul 27, 2024 · How They Taste: Super-sweet and crisp, ideal for eating raw. How to Shop and Store: Look for Vidalias in the markets between late April and early September. Firm, medium-sized onions without any bruises will taste the best. To store, wrap each onion in a paper towel and store in the fridge; they'll keep for weeks. WebAug 16, 2014 · Hardneck Garlic Hardneck garlic ( Allium sativum ophioscorodon) tend to have more flavor than their soft-necked cousins. They're characterized by hard woody central stalks and a long flower stalk (scape) that loops and curls, usually twice. They tend to have four to twelve cloves in each bulb.
